Core Components of Ramp Parts: Building Blocks of Accessibility
Every good ramp system relies on a set of key ramp parts that come together to create a safe and functional pathway. These components include:
1. Ramp Decks
The ramp deck forms the surface that users walk or roll on. It must be made of slip-resistant, durable materials such as aluminum, steel, or high-quality composite. The design considerations include width, slope, and surface texture to ensure maximum safety.
2. Support Frames and Side Handrails
Support frames provide structural integrity, ensuring the ramp maintains its shape over time. Side handrails offer additional stability and balance for users, especially for the elderly or disabled individuals. Elegant yet sturdy handrail systems are crucial safety features.
3. Ramp Feet and Base Plates
These ramp parts anchor the system securely to the ground and prevent shifting or wobbling. Materials like galvanized steel or rust-proof aluminum are preferred for outdoor installations.
4. Connecting Hardware
Includes bolts, screws, brackets, and clamps that secure the various ramp parts together. High-quality hardware ensures the stability of the entire ramp and makes future maintenance easier.
5. Transition Plates and Thresholds
Transition plates bridge the gap between the ramp and adjacent flooring or doorways. They must be smooth, slip-resistant, and capable of supporting heavy loads without creasing or warping.
Choosing the Right Ramp Parts: Factors to Consider
The selection of ramp parts depends on multiple factors tailored to the specific environment, user needs, and budget. Careful consideration of these elements can significantly improve the outcome:
Material Quality and Durability
- Aluminum: Lightweight, corrosion-resistant, ideal for outdoor use.
- Steel: Heavy-duty, highly durable, but requires rust protection.
- Composite materials: Non-slip, weather-resistant, and easy to maintain.
Load Capacity
Depending on the expected weight to be supported, select ramp parts with appropriate load ratings to prevent failure and ensure safety for all users.
Compliance with Accessibility Standards
Standards like the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) specify dimensions, slope, and safety features for ramps. Choosing ramp parts that meet these regulations guarantees the ramp's legal compliance.
Environmental Resistance
For outdoor applications, choose ramp parts that are resistant to rust, corrosion, UV damage, and temperature fluctuations. This prolongs the ramp's lifespan and reduces repair costs.
